The PS4 Pro offers 4K Display along with HDR capabilities

If you've been paying attention to rumors and updates regarding the PS4 Pro, you would say that this one seems to be the most mainstream of them all. But it's also definitely the main reason why you should buy a PS4 Pro over the original. While, technically speaking, the PS4 Pro doesn't really produce a lot of games at native 4K resolution, it does, however, visibly upgrade the resolution of a lot of titles to some degree. INFAMOUS: First Light & Second Sun are examples of these games, where both titles get upgraded up to a native 1800P before being up-converted using a couple of incredibly clever techniques. Cutting to the chase, even though the PS4 Pro doesn't offer a purely native 4K experience, the games that you play on it would still look as though it is.

You can now share the experience of utter graphical satisfaction

If you acquire a brand new PS4 Pro, while your friend doesn't, you can still have them experience amazing graphics upgrades through the console's all-new Share Play mode. Since you're the one with the upgraded console, you would want to share the experience with your buddies, which you could definitely do now. Previously the PS4 could only Share Play to other PS4 owners at up to 720P. But with the increased power of the PS4 Pro, it would mean that you and your buddy can now jump up to 1080P!

Stream & Share in style

The PlayStation 4 Pro is able to stream to the world's favorite time-wasting video service at an amazing 1080P in 60 fps. This means that if you're an avid streamer, your viewers will be able to get even more detail when viewing you play your games.
